Были у меня в детстве часы Электроника 7-21, потом они сдохли и очень много лет провалялись в гараже. Недавно достал их и ностальгические чувства заставили меня решиться оживить эти часы. Да не просто так, а полностью их переделать, оставив корпус и ВЛИ индикатор. https://pp.userapi.com/c840721/v840721570/4afdd/3o1alj9asKg.jpg Пока что я нахожусь в раздумьях, с чего начать и на чем собирать часы. Первое, что приходит на ум, это модульная система из часов реального времени с I2C интерфейсом (DS3231) и отладочной платы STM32F103C8T6 (или на ардуино nano, на время сборки на макетной плате и тестов, а после уже развести на плате место под мегу). То и другое у меня как раз есть Ещё хочется вынести БП из корпуса, например использовать БП от ноутбука. Заменить контактные группы на тактовые кнопки. Пока я ещё даже не разобрался как работает данный вли, и пока я это делаю, надеюсь кто нибудь мне поможет советами и ссылками. Кто бы что и как делал, если бы собирал такие часы? p.s. ещё я хочу в часы внешний датчик температуры встроить, который будет висеть на улице. Но пока не решил, беспроводной или проводной Документация на часы https://yadi.sk/d/NEPQYmwm3Rdr3b
Назначение клавиш клавиатуры тоже изменится. * - установка будильника Сигнал - отключение будильника ТВ - температура воздуха Прг - программирование (режим установки времени) ТМ - таймер обратного отсчета (который пищит по истечении установленного времени) С - сброс (стереть введенное число в режимах прг, тм, будильник). Стрелка вверх - применить, ввод (по аналогии с Enter или OK)
Думаю, вам надо начать с внимательного изучения принципов работы ВЛИ. После этого, вероятно, желание переделывать штатную схему питания у вас пропадет. ВЛИ требует как минимум 2 напряжения питания: накал, обычно от 1 до 5 вольт, желательно переменное, и анодное обычно от 12 до 30 вольт. Почитать про использование ВЛИ на практике можно например в соответствующей теме на радиокоте. http://radiokot.ru/forum/viewtopic.php?f=3&t=27324 В принципе, сам способ индикации ничуть не отличается от многоразрядных светодиодных индикаторов, но для связи с МК вам потребуются ключи для согласования анодного напряжения и логических уровней. Так что отладить программу можно на макетке со светодиодными индикаторами, при переходе к ключам ВЛИ возможно потребуется инвертировать уровни в программе.
В американских патентах вроде шим с большой частотой и определенной скважностью на накале, и никакой переменки. На этом индикаторе накал точно 5В переменки.
Да, забыл упомянуть, переменка берется с обмотки трансформатора со средней точкой. Такое питание нужно для исключения градиента яркости вдоль накала на длинных ВЛИ. Тут еще можете посмотреть https://www.noritake-elec.com/technology/general-technical-information/vfd-operation ШИМ с большой частотой с скважностью не знаю зачем там нужен. Разве что анодным напряжением накал питать. Можно наверное в цикле сканирования снимать полностью анодное/сеточное, давать импульс в накал и, пока он горячий, осуществлять новый цикл сканирования.
Решил именно так и поступить. Для начала собрал матричную клавиатуру для отладки ) https://pp.userapi.com/c830400/v830400252/65719/HTBY_Od1h7c.jpg
Набросал инфографику из инфы, которую по этому индикатору нашел. Маркировка в стиле оригинала: Более наглядная адаптация с логичной маркировкой сегментов: